Understanding the Size: 275/65R18

The numbers and letters in 275/65R18 specify the tire’s dimensions. The “275” is the tire width in millimeters, “65” is the aspect ratio (the height of the sidewall as a percentage of the width), “R” indicates radial construction, and “18” is the wheel diameter in inches. This size fits many trucks and SUVs, providing a balance between off-road capability and on-road comfort.

Installation and Maintenance Tips

  • I had the tires professionally installed and balanced to ensure optimal performance.
  • Regular rotation every 5,000 to 7,000 miles helped me maintain even tread wear.
  • I monitored tire pressure regularly, especially before off-road trips, to maximize traction and tire life.
